New Holland NH 4187 – EHR (Electronic Hitch Regulation / Electro-Hydraulic Remote) Control Unit: EHR Joystick potentiometer Y short circuit
Issue description
The system has detected a short circuit in the Y-axis (forward/backward movement) potentiometer of the Electro-Hydraulic Remote (EHR) joystick. The controller is receiving a voltage signal that is out of the expected range, indicating a failure in the potentiometer itself, a short in the wiring harness, or a connector issue.

Check the cause
Inspect connector C306 for pushed-back pins, moisture, or corrosion.
Check the lever potentiometer resistance: Disconnect the EHR control unit connector C306. While moving the joystick lever, measure the resistance between connector C306 pin 6 (PC59--Y) and C306 pin 1 (3220 O/LTG/S). It should read between 100 Ohms and 900 Ohms. Measure between C306 pin 6 and C306 pin 2 (B). It should read between 900 Ohms and 100 Ohms.
Check for +5 Volts reference: Turn the ignition key ON. Measure the voltage between connector C306 pin 1 and C306 pin 2. It should be approximately +5 Volts.
Check for an open circuit: Turn the ignition key OFF. Disconnect harness connectors C324 and C325. Check continuity between C324 pin 23 and C306 pin 2, and between C325 pin 17 and C306 pin 1.
Check for a short to ground: Measure continuity between connector C306 pin 1 and a known good chassis ground.
Repair steps
Power Down
Turn off the tractor and locate the EHR joystick control unit on the armrest console.
Harness Inspection & Repair
Based on the diagnostic checks above, if the voltage is incorrect, or if an open circuit/short to ground is found, locate the damaged section of the wiring harness. Repair or replace the affected wiring and re-test.
Potentiometer Replacement
If the wiring harness tests perfectly (delivering ~5V with no shorts or opens) but the resistance values of the lever potentiometer are out of the 100-900 Ohm specification, the potentiometer has failed internally.
Component Swap
Remove the faulty EHR control unit / joystick assembly from the armrest and install the replacement unit.
Verification
Reconnect all harnesses, turn the key ON, clear the stored fault codes, and operate the joystick through its full Y-axis range to ensure the code does not return and the hydraulics respond correctly.
